Udaipur, January 27: The Sajjangarh Wildlife Sanctuary Eco-Sensitive Zone Monitoring Committee convened on Monday under the chairmanship of District Collector Arvind Poswal at the Mini Auditorium of the District Collectorate. The meeting focused on key aspects of the Master Plan for the Eco-Sensitive Zone (ESZ), including conservation strategies and the approval of land conversion proposals.
District Collector Poswal emphasized that all new construction approvals in the ESZ must strictly adhere to the Master Plan’s regulations. He also provided clear directives to the officials present to ensure the effective conservation of the sensitive zone.

Land Conversion Cases Reviewed and Approved
The committee reviewed seven cases of land conversion within the Sajjangarh Wildlife Sanctuary Eco-Sensitive Zone. After detailed discussions with officials from various departments, three cases were approved in accordance with the established guidelines.
